How does it work?
Seeds of Peace creates opportunity for youth to meet peers from different backgrounds and life experiences, engage in honest dialogue, forge relationships of trust and commitment, and build skills to work for change, all with access to a powerful global network.
We invest in young people locally, nationally, and internationally—partnering with schools and organizations that are invested in students.
We believe young people have ideas that can make their communities thrive.
In partnership with you, we provide mentorship, inspiration, and support.
We connect youth—who might otherwise never meet—across racial, religious, class, and political lines and develop leaders who are committed to moving from ideas to action.
All Seeds of Peace programs focus on:
» Dialogue that provides space for self-expression, deep listening, and exploration of core conflict issues
» Community that builds an ecosystem of support and solidarity across lines of difference
» Leadership skills development that trains youth in facilitation, organizing, and advocacy
» Action-taking that creates real, tangible change in our communities right now

Over the past 29 years, more than 8,000 Seeds of Peace alumni have found a place in this vibrant global community of leaders, working across our deep divides, to create a more just and peaceful reality in their communities around the world.
Founded in 1993 to advance Arab-Israeli peace, Seeds of Peace now works with youth in the United States, Israel, Palestine, Egypt, Jordan, India, Pakistan and the United Kingdom, with alumni in 63 countries.
What are Seeds of Peace Partners?
Seeds of Peace partners are schools and community organizations that sponsor young people relationally and/or financially to attend our intensive summer programs.
Partners are an ongoing support for those young people as they engage with the wider Seeds of Peace network.
What does that partnership look like?
Partners …
» Nominate applicants to Seeds of Peace Programs
» Support youth during the application, interview, and orientation process
» Provide funding or support for creative funding solutions
» Select an adult liaison that will coordinate with Seeds of Peace and support youth locally throughout the year
Seeds of Peace provides …
» Intensive youth programs
» Curricular resources and consulting to support youth year-round
» Ongoing programs to sustain community and support youth-led action-taking
» Professional development training for adult allies and educators
» Access to our alumni network
